
First Lady Donates 1,000 Bags of Rice to Christian Community in Yobe
By Kinsley Benson
The wife of the President, Mrs. Remi Tinubu, has donated 1,000 bags of 25kg rice to the Christian community in Yobe State to celebrate Christmas.
Mr. Yahaya Galo, a committee member of the Christian Northern Nigeria Political Forum (CNPF), disclosed this on Tuesday in Potiskum.
He said the gesture was part of the first lady’s efforts to support the less privileged.
Galo appreciated the first lady for the kind gesture and called on other well-meaning Nigerians to emulate her.
Also speaking, Mr. Saidu Ajeje, the Coordinator of the forum in Yobe State, prayed for God to guide President Tinubu and his wife throughout their tenure.
Ajeje noted that if people in positions of authority were willing to assist others, many Nigerians would not be suffering.
One of the beneficiaries, Mr. Usuku Kuku, who represented retired pastors in the state, thanked the first lady for putting smiles on the faces of Christians in Yobe.
Kuku stated that this was the first time such support had been given to them by any first lady.
The donation is part of the first lady’s broader initiative to support vulnerable communities across the country, particularly in the northern region.
